42 ResourceTree Jobs
Senior Lead Data Engineer - Spark/Hadoop (8-10 yrs)
ResourceTree
posted 12hr ago
Key skills for the job
Role : Senior Lead Data Engineer
Years of Experience : 8+yrs
Location : Chennai(Hybrid)
No of Opening : 1
Job Description :
We are seeking a highly skilled Senior Lead Data Engineer to oversee the design, development, and optimization of our data infrastructure and integration processes. This role requires extensive experience in data engineering, leadership abilities, and proficiency in modern data technologies. Join us to drive innovation and lead a dynamic team in delivering robust data solutions.
Primary Skills : Azure, ADF, Databricks, DBT
Secondary Skills : AWS, Snowflake
Role Description :
The Lead Data Engineer will be responsible for overseeing the design, development, and maintenance of our data infrastructure and pipelines. This role requires strong technical expertise, leadership skills, and the ability to work collaboratively with cross-functional teams to ensure efficient and reliable data processes.
Role Responsibility :
- Lead the design and architecture of scalable and robust data integration solutions on-premise and in the cloud.
- Ensure solutions meet business requirements and industry standards.
- Engage with executive leadership and key stakeholders to understand business needs and translate them into technical solutions.
- Define data models, schemas, and structures to optimize data storage, retrieval, and processing for analytical workloads.
Role Requirement :
- Proficient in basic and advanced SQL.
- Proficient in using Python for data integration and data engineering tasks.
- Proficiency in ETL/ELT tools such as Informatica, Talend, SSIS, DBT, Databricks or equivalent.
- Experience with relational databases (likeSQL Server, Oracle, MySQL, PostgreSQL) and NoSQL databases (like MongoDB, Cassandra), cloud databases (RedShift, Snowflake, Azure SQL).
- Familiarity with big data technologies like Hadoop, Spark, Kafka, and cloud platforms such as AWS, Azure, or Google Cloud.
- Solid understanding of data modeling, data warehousing concepts, and practices.
- Good Knowledge and Understanding of Data warehouse concepts (Dimensional
- Work with data architects and solution
architects toensure alignment with
overall data strategy andarchitecture
principles.
Lead a team of data engineers by
providing technical guidance,
mentorship, and support. Plan,
prioritize, and manage data
engineeringprojects, tasks, and
timelines.
Design, develop, and maintain data
integrationpipelines and ETL/ELT
workflows.
Lead more than one project or manage
a largerteam that might have sub-
tracks.
Modeling, change data capture, slowlychanging
dimensions etc.).
Knowledgeable in performance tuningand optimization
Experience in Data Profiling and Datavalidation
Experience in requirements gatheringand
documentation processes and performing unit testing.
Understanding and Implementing QA andvarious testing
process in the project.
Knowledge in any BI tools will be anadded advantage.
Sound aptitude, outstanding logicalreasoning, and
analytical skills.
Willingness to learn and take initiatives.Ability to adapt to
fast-paced Agile environment.
Relevant certifications in data engineering or cloud platforms
are a plus.
Additional Requirement:
Minimum of 8-10 years of experience in data engineering, focusing on data integration, data warehousing, and big data
technologies.
At least 3-5 years in a leadership role, demonstrating the ability to manage and mentor engineering teams and lead complex
projects.
Functional Areas: Software/Testing/Networking
Read full job description